The propagation characteristic of underwater sound wave is the best in all kind of energy that we all know. Sound wave has information about scalar field and vector field. But pressure sensor was predominant in underwater acoustic field for a long time. A vector sensor is an acoustic transducer composed of homocentric acoustic pressure sensors and particle velocity sensors that measure simultaneously scalar quantity(pressure) and vector quantity(pressure gradient, particle velocity, acceleration, displacement ,etc) at the same location. The vector sensor injects more life to acoustic signal processing and sensor technology. The vector sensor was successfully applied in weak signal detection, direction of arrival estimation, torpedo control and guide, etc.In this thesis, based on the historical retrospect of the development, the actuality and the applications of the direction of arrival with vector sensor array, high resolution method and its stability of linear array with 2-D vector sensor were researched. Firstly, a model of unambiguous DOA estimation using vector sensor linear array was designed, the performance of DOA estimation was researched when vector sensor linear array lies on different axis of coordinate and combination directive function was produced based on the vector vertical linear array using 2-D sensor, whose velocity Vx and Vy direct X axis and Y axis and vector linear array lies on Z axis. Bartlett Beamformer and conventional MUSIC method using this vector sensor array were given. It is the first time to deduce spectrum estimation function of MUSIC method based on 2-D vector sensor uniform linear array with 3 sensors. Two algorithms based on decorrelation MUSIC method were studied. The model of vector sensor array error and the effect of Amplitude-Phase error, Axial error and Doppler Frequency-shift on high resolution method were analyzed. Joint-Search way of phase error and DOA estimation using Nich-GA were given. The model and all algorithms were researched via theory and simulation. The model of unambiguous DOA estimation, Bartlett Beamformer, conventional MUSIC method and calibration way were verified by dealing with the experimental data obtained from SONG HUA lake.at the end of this paper.
